5 Essential Tips to Infuse Creativity into Your Workspace
Creating a workspace that fosters creativity is essential for productivity and innovation. To get started, consider the following 5 essential tips that can help infuse creativity into your environment:
- Personalize Your Space: Adding personal touches such as photographs, art, or inspirational quotes can ignite creativity. Surrounding yourself with items that resonate with you can evoke positive emotions and inspire new ideas.
- Incorporate Nature: Bringing elements of nature inside, such as plants or natural light, can significantly enhance your mood and stimulate creative thinking. Studies have shown that a connection to nature can boost cognitive function.
Additionally, consider making your workspace more dynamic:
- Change Your Layout: Sometimes, all it takes is a new perspective. Rearranging your desk or changing your seating arrangements can inspire fresh thoughts and innovation.
- Utilize Creative Tools: Invest in tools that encourage creativity, such as whiteboards for brainstorming or art supplies for quick sketches of ideas. Having the right resources at your fingertips can make a big difference.
- Schedule Breaks: Lastly, don’t underestimate the power of a break. Stepping away from your work allows your mind to wander, often leading to breakthroughs and new perspectives.

How to Organize Your Workspace for Maximum Inspiration
Creating an inspiring workspace begins with organization. Start by decluttering your desk and removing items that don’t serve a purpose or inspire you. This might include old paperwork, unused office supplies, and even decorations that no longer resonate. Once you’ve cleared your space, consider categorizing your remaining items. Use drawers for storage, implement file systems for documents, and designate specific areas for essential tools. This newfound order not only enhances productivity but also helps in fueling creativity. A clean workspace is a blank canvas waiting for inspiration to flourish.
Another key aspect of organizing your workspace is the arrangement of furniture and fixtures. Position your desk near a window to take advantage of natural light, which can greatly boost your mood and energy levels. To encourage creativity, incorporate elements that inspire you, such as plants, artwork, or motivational quotes displayed on the wall. Additionally, ensure that your work area is comfortable—invest in ergonomic furniture and keep everything within arm's reach. The layout of your space can significantly impact your ability to think creatively and remain motivated throughout the day.
Can a Beautiful Workspace Boost Your Productivity?
Creating a beautiful workspace is not just about aesthetics; it can significantly influence your productivity levels. Numerous studies have shown that an appealing work environment can enhance focus, creativity, and overall job satisfaction. When your workspace is organized and visually pleasing, it reduces distractions and fosters a sense of calm, allowing you to concentrate better on your tasks. Investing in quality decor, ergonomic furniture, and personalized touches can make you look forward to spending time in your workspace, leading to higher efficiency and better outcomes.
Moreover, a well-designed workspace can promote positive habits and routines. For instance, incorporating elements such as natural lighting, plants, or art can stimulate the mind and boost motivation. Additionally, the layout of your workspace plays a crucial role; having a designated area for work can signal your brain that it’s time to focus. It's essential to create a balance between functionality and beauty, as this equilibrium can transform your workspace into a productivity powerhouse.
